The interactive wall keeps kids entertained while an adult grabs the tickets. The crayon imitates your movements!

 

Each guest receives a clear bag to collect their artwork in, and 2 tokens to use on various stations.

 

After getting our tickets, we headed upstairs to where there are 26 hands-on attractions. We love naming and wrapping our own Crayola crayon. This is a station that accepts the tokens. (Additional tokens can be purchased).

Naming our Crayon: You pick which color you want, and then design your label.

 

The finished products!

 

Our daughter really wanted to see the live show to learn how crayons are made. They show how they melt the wax, how it’s molded, labeled and packaged. It’s a fun show, and the animated characters keep the kids entertained.

 

One of the coolest new attractions is Rockin’ Paper. Kids can color a fairy or a dinosaur, then watch it come to life and dance to the music on a stage through the use of magnets. It was so fun to watch! Check it out below.

There are so many attractions to do and see. We spent 3 hours and didn’t do everything. I really like the Toddler Town area play gym so the littles can burn off some energy, and the huge light-up peg wall will keep a toddler entertained for awhile. The facility is clean and there are family bathrooms.

In addition to the shows and attractions, Cafe Crayola offers pizza and other kid-friendly options, and the Snack Shack has quick snacks such as pretzels and popcorn. The Crayola Store has a huge selection of products for babies, toddlers, kids and color enthusiasts of all ages.
